Precautions Before using this product, please read this User Manual carefully and keep it well
Please use a reliable grounded socket, Do not overload the socket, or it may cause fire or
electric shock.
Do not cover or block the vent hole in the rear casing, and do not use the product on a bed,
sofa, blanket or similar objects.
The range of the supply voltage of the monitor is printed on the label on the rear casing.
If it is impossible to determine the supply voltage, please consult the distributor or local
power company.
If the monitor will not be used for a long period, please cut off the power supply to avoid
electric shock in rainy days and damage due to abnormal supply voltage.
Keep the monitor away from water sources or damp places, such as bath rooms, kitchens,
basements and swimming pools.
Make sure the monitor is placed on a flat surface. If the monitor falls down, it may cause
human injury or device damage.
Store and use the monitor in a cool, dry and well ventilated place, and keep it away from
emission and heat sources.
Do not put foreign matters into the monitor, or it may cause short circuits resulting fire or
electric shock.
Do not disassemble or repair this product by self to avoid electric shock. If faults occur,
please contact the after-sales service directly.
Do not pull or twist the power cable forcedly.
There is a polarizer layer (not a protective film) on the surface of the screen. Do not peel
it off, or the product may be damaged and the warranty will be invalid.

Description of buttons
Menu button: Press to enter sub-menus/ quickly enter the main menu
Down button: Press to move down in the menu/quickly adjust the brightness
Up button: Press to move up in the menu/quickly adjust the volume
Exit/hot key: Press to return to the previous menu/quickly switch input signals of the port
Power button: Press to turn on/off the monitor
Button Function
1
2
3
4
5
Explanation of indicator light
6. Indicator light: If the white light is normally on, it is indicated that the device is powered on, and that
the monitor is running normally. red light indicates no video signal detected or low voltage. Please
make sure that your computer is turned on and all video cables are fully plugged in and/or connected.
